Is about our memory capacities, how they interact, and how they give rise to knowledge. Some of topics I've been interested include:
The inaccuracy of episodic memory (Schwartz, 2018, Essays in Philosophy);
The relationship between procedural memory and propositional knowledge (Schwartz and Drayson, 2019, Philosophical Psychology);
The biological functions of episodic memory (Schwartz, 2020, Review of Philosophy and Psychology);
The relationship between memory and belief (Schwartz, 2022, Synthese);
The natural kind distinctions between episodic memory, semantic memory, and imagination (Schwartz, 2025, Philosophical Psychology);
The representational format and content of cognitive maps (Schwartz & Fresco, 2025, Synthese).
The distribution of episodic memory across non-human species (Schwartz & Boyle, [Forthcoming] British Journal for the Philosophy of Science).
